In vitro propagation and Pharmaceutical evaluation of Kappaphycusalvareziiand Eucheuma Denticulatum, two Commercially important seaweeds of Sabah
In Sabah, the problems associated with using conventional methods to cultivate seaweeds are mainly suitable sites for farming, seasonal variations and disease infestations.
